Offensive lineman Jah Reid was arrested and charged with two misdemeanor battery counts after an altercation at a bar in Key West, Fla., reports The Baltimore Sun.
"We have learned of the situation and are gathering information," said Ravens Director of Public Relations Chad Steele.
Reid, 25, is heading into his fourth season. The former third-round pick out of Central Florida played in 10 games last year but did not start in any.
He is the third Ravens player to be arrested this offseason, following running back Ray Rice and wide receiver Deonte Thompson.
